Quick note for plugin authors testing against Graphlet's dependency visualizer: the test plan covers cycle detection, lazy node expansion, and the new edge-bundling mode. Please exercise graphs above 5k nodes — that's where layout jank shows up. File anything weird against the Maplewick staging board. To hit the staging render API during your runs, authenticate with the bearer token below.

session JWT of yawep-yawep = eyJhbGciOiJIUzI1NiIsInR5cCI6IkpXVCJ9.eyJzdWIiOiI3pWF3_In0.aXYsHiog

Q2 Planning Note — Sales Leads

Big one this quarter: we're pushing Veldora Systems into the Osthaven region. Two reps relocate in April, and the Port Calloway office opens soon after. Expect a slower ramp than Midvale — the market there is crowded and price-sensitive. Targets will be set conservatively for the first two quarters, then reviewed. Territory assignments come out next week. The thinking behind this move is captured in the note below.

management briefing: Project Ulavan slips by two quarters because of the staffing delay.

Handover: six returned demo units from the Kellwright trade booth are boxed on dock 2, labelled RETURN-DEMO. All cables accounted for, one cracked screen noted on the slip. Pickup by Arrowvale Transit tomorrow before noon. Confirm the driver against the manifest photo first. Give the courier the release phrase printed on the next line.

handover note for yagef-bagep: the drudor pelius courier leaves the kasdor zorvan norir ledger at gate 8016 under passcode 755406